The Book of the Prayer

2/6. Chapter:

Maintaining The 'Asr Prayer

Sunan Ibn Majah

حَدَّثَنَا أَحْمَدُ بْنُ عَبْدَةَ، حَدَّثَنَا حَمَّادُ بْنُ زَيْدٍ، عَنْ عَاصِمِ بْنِ بَهْدَلَةَ، عَنْ زِرِّ بْنِ حُبَيْشٍ، عَنْ عَلِيِّ بْنِ أَبِي طَالِبٍ، أَنَّ رَسُولَ اللَّهِ ـ صلى الله عليه وسلم ـ قَالَ يَوْمَ الْخَنْدَقِ ‏ "‏ مَلأَ اللَّهُ بُيُوتَهُمْ وَقُبُورَهُمْ نَارًا كَمَا شَغَلُونَا عَنِ الصَّلاَةِ الْوُسْطَى ‏"‏ ‏.‏

It was narrated from 'Ali bin Abu Talib that,: On the Day of Khandaq, the Messenger of Allah said: "May Allah fill their houses and graves with fire, just as they distracted us from the middle prayer."

Reference : Sunan Ibn Majah 684In-book reference : Book 2, Hadith 18English translation : Vol. 1, Book 2, Hadith 684
